Nema Nara Niono Nampla Lere Niafunke Timbuktu
Once did that route 3 years ago
Today my biggest concern would be the Toureg rebellion that s moved a bit south recently (Nampala ambush of Mil. Camp 2 weeks ago). Apart this I would deem the route equally "dangerous/not dangerous" as the direct one Nema Timbuktu, which I have unfortunately never taken, but has been described well in this thread.
